People must decide what kind of Government they want: Chamling

GANGTOK, Feb 16 : With Assembly elections inching closer, Chief Minister Pawan Chamling today spoke about the work done by his 15-year-old Sikkim Democratic Front (SDF) government in front of a massive gathering during the state-level Panchayat Sammelan here.

The Chief Minister also sensitised the Panchayats about their responsibilities.
“Sikkim has been accorded the number one status in the country for total sanitation. It is the duty of the Panchayats, who are the grassroots government, to maintain this recognition,” Chamling said.

The chief minister also highlighted the development work done by his government since 1994.

“Roads have reached every nook and corner of the state. In the past five years, the state government has built 1,422 kms of roads all over in Sikkim,” he said.
“The SDF government, in the past 14 years, has pumped Rs 300 crore for the 4,600 schemes for drinking water supply in the state. A sum of Rs 54 crore has been spent for construction of 1003 bridges, besides construction of 1,151 model houses at a cost of Rs 40 crore,” Chamling said.

“Till now, we have distributed 25,821 LPG gas connections to the economically backward people,” he added. At the outset of his lengthy speech, the chief minister briefly told the gathering of Panchayats from all over the state that he will not make it an ‘election speech’.

“But I will tell only this much that people must be serious about their responsibility to elect a good government,” he said.

“As elections are coming, people should not think who should be their MLAs or which party should form the government they should instead seriously think on what kind of government they want to elect that will protect their future and develop Sikkim,” Chamling said.

“People must be clear about under whose leadership their futures are protected,” he said.

Earlier, in his speech, state Rural Development Minister K N Rai was more direct regarding the ruling SDF’s expectations for the coming elections. “SDF will form the next government,” he announced.
